Movie ‘Earthlings’ studies those who study Klingon

Earthlings: Ugly Bags of Mostly Water (imdb.com entry) is a documentary about the Klingon Language Institute (site, including Klingon E-cards) and the language and science-fiction aficianados who speak Star Trek‘s invented Klingon language. GSN National Vocabulary Championship

American cable network GSN: The Network for Games (site) has launched the National Vocabulary Championship for high school students. The top U.S. student wins $40,000 towards college tuition.
